Okay
  Public Ticket #3736458
features
Closed

Comments

  • Geo started the conversation

    Greetings, so we were asked to find a calendar to use it for street musician management at the local municipality. This will be working as a schedule platform with some restrictions (I will explain).

    There will a map of the area and on the map (we will create a custom map) will be marked spots where the street musicians will be able to book.

    So, we wanted a calendar that will manage the days of the musicians will be working and in which spot.

    Here are some restrictions we want:

    -Each musician will be able to book a spot on the calendar for a max of 15 days per month per spot! Meaning a street musician can NOT book the same spot twice.

    -Each spot will be unique that means if a spot is booked, no one else will be able to book it for the same days.

    -The user (street musician) should be able to log in with username and pass provide some information (that we need) and then book a spot for 15 days max, after this period will pass, he can NOT book the same spot again, he can book another spot though.

    -A user (street musician) that has already booked a spot, will NOT be able to book another spot for the same days. Keep in mind each musician will be able to book a spot on the calendar for a max of 15 days per month. (15 days per month per spot! Meaning a street musician can NOT book the same spot twice).

    Why we thought about your Plug in?

    We saw that in the plug in you can use a calendar and can manage and set up reservations-bookings. Based on that we thought that if we use the spots as “apartments” or rooms for example (each spot will be a room) and set up booking days and reservations (for the spots-rooms), does this cover what we want to do?

    We are here for further discussion. 

  •  698
    Stefan replied

    Hi Geo,

    Thanks for reaching out to us. Unfortunatelly, this would not be possible to configure within Amelia features, allow me to explain how Amelia works. First of all, you would need to configure employees and services. These services are displayed on the booking form where a customer can select a service or employee. They would book a particular timeslot for a certain day, for a certain service, but there is no option to book multiple days. Maximum service duration is 24 hours, therefore it's not possible to configure the service duration longer than this.

    This particular timeslot can be configured to be booked once, so when one customer books this timeslot, then the other ones would not be able to book the same one. As for the option for customers (musicians) to be able to log in, there is a customer panel, but this panel doesn't allow customers to book the appointments through the customer panel, they would need to do that from the booking form.

    At last, I wanted to provide the link to demo, so you can get a better overview of how Amelia works. Here it is - demos.

    I hope I cleared a bit. 

    Kind Regards, 

    Stefan Petrov
    [email protected]

    Rate my support

    wpDataTables: FAQ | Facebook | Twitter | InstagramFront-end and back-end demo | Docs

    Amelia: FAQ | Facebook | Twitter | InstagramAmelia demo sites | Docs | Discord Community

    You can try wpDataTables add-ons before purchasing on these sandbox sites:

    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ables

  • Geo replied

    Yeah i understand that but why a customer won't be able to book more days? Let's say there is a pshychology service, or a physiotherapy service, why is he not able to book more than 1 day in one go? something like booking a room in a hotel -- it's the same mindset of what we want to achieve.

  •  698
    Stefan replied

    Hi Geo,

    This is because the maximum service duration is 24 hours, as stated, therefore there is no option to configure the duration longer than 24 hours. Customers are only able to book certain time (appointment) for a service. There is a feature called "Cart", but this allows customers to book multiple appointments per one booking, but no multiple days.

     

    Kind Regards, 

    Stefan Petrov
    [email protected]

    Rate my support

    wpDataTables: FAQ | Facebook | Twitter | InstagramFront-end and back-end demo | Docs

    Amelia: FAQ | Facebook | Twitter | InstagramAmelia demo sites | Docs | Discord Community

    You can try wpDataTables add-ons before purchasing on these sandbox sites:

    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ables